What is Holistic Therapy?

Holistic therapy refers to a range of recovery practices that concentrate on promoting general well-being instead of solely resolving specific symptoms or illnesses. This method highlights the interconnectedness of all aspects of a specific and emphasizes that optimal health can be accomplished through well balanced physical, emotional, mental, and spiritual systems.

Common Holistic Therapy Practices

Holistic therapy encompasses a large range of practices. Here is a list of popular techniques:

  1. Acupuncture: Traditional Chinese medication that includes placing thin needles into particular points on the body to balance energy flow.
  2. Aromatherapy: The usage of vital oils for healing advantages, frequently in conjunction with massage or other therapies.
  3. Yoga: A physical, mental, and spiritual practice that combines postures, breathing workouts, and meditation to enhance total health.
  4. Massage Therapy: Various strategies used to control muscles and tissues, promoting relaxation and easing stress.
  5. Meditation: Techniques that foster heightened awareness and emotional guideline, frequently causing stress decrease and mental clearness.
  6. Nutritional Counseling: Focuses on dietary modifications that can promote health and prevent disease, stressing whole foods and balanced nutrition.
  7. Reiki: A Japanese method that promotes recovery through energy transfer, encouraging relaxation and minimizing stress.

Frequently Asked Questions About Holistic Therapy

1. Is holistic therapy suitable for everyone?

Yes, holistic therapy can benefit individuals of all ages and backgrounds. However, it's necessary for individuals to speak with doctor to determine the very best method for their specific conditions.

2. Can holistic therapy replace standard treatments?

Holistic therapy is best used as a complementary technique to standard treatments. While it can enhance well-being and support recovery, it ought to not replace essential medical interventions.

3. How do I pick a holistic therapist?

Consider the therapist's credentials, training, and alignment with your particular requirements. Try to find specialists who have actually been certified in their particular modalities and have great evaluations or suggestions.

4. How long does it require to see results from holistic therapy?

The timeline for observing results can vary widely depending upon private situations, the type of therapy, and the problems addressed. Some may see immediate relief, while others may require more prolonged treatment for thorough healing.

5. Exist any risks related to holistic therapy?

While holistic therapies are typically safe, it's essential to inform your holistic practitioner about your health history and any medications you are taking to avoid prospective interactions or adverse effects.
